Subject: [PATCH 1/4] USB: gadget: f_rndis: fix bitrate for SuperSpeed and above
Date: Thu, 26 Nov 2020 19:09:34 +0100 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20201126180937.255892-1-gregkh@linuxfoundation.org> (raw)
From: Will McVicker <willmcvicker@google.com>
Align the SuperSpeed Plus bitrate for f_rndis to match f_ncm's ncm_bitrate
defined by commit 1650113888fe ("usb: gadget: f_ncm: add SuperSpeed descriptors
for CDC NCM").

drivers/usb/gadget/function/f_rndis.c | 4 +++-
1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/drivers/usb/gadget/function/f_rndis.c b/drivers/usb/gadget/function/f_rndis.c
index 9534c8ab62a8..0739b05a0ef7 100644
--- a/drivers/usb/gadget/function/f_rndis.c
+++ b/drivers/usb/gadget/function/f_rndis.c
@@ -87,8 +87,10 @@ static inline struct f_rndis *func_to_rndis(struct usb_function *f)
/* peak (theoretical) bulk transfer rate in bits-per-second */
static unsigned int bitrate(struct usb_gadget *g)
{
+ if (gadget_is_superspeed(g) && g->speed >= USB_SPEED_SUPER_PLUS)
+ return 4250000000U;
if (gadget_is_superspeed(g) && g->speed == USB_SPEED_SUPER)
- return 13 * 1024 * 8 * 1000 * 8;
+ return 3750000000U;
else if (gadget_is_dualspeed(g) && g->speed == USB_SPEED_HIGH)
return 13 * 512 * 8 * 1000 * 8;
else
